Khabib has cauliflower ear, also known as wrestler’s ear, which is caused by direct trauma to the blood vessels in the outer ear. Although it swells up when these vessels burst, resulting in a distinct deformity, there is no evidence to suggest that his legacy stems from the appearance of his ears. His achievements speak for themselves. He is a two-time Combat Sambo Champion and a veteran of ProFC. Additionally, Fight Matrix has ranked him as the greatest lightweight of all time.

Nurmagomedov made his debut in 2012, defeating [name] via third-round submission. He went on to compile an impressive winning streak, defeating notable opponents such as [names]. After a series of injuries and fight cancellations, Nurmagomedov finally received his shot at the UFC lightweight title in April 2018. He faced [name] at UFC 223 and emerged victorious.
Following UFC 254, Nurmagomedov announced his retirement. The decision was influenced by personal reasons, including the passing of his father and coach. In an interview on the ‘Full Send’ Podcast, he clarified the authenticity of his retirement:
